Common styles include straw-slot or straw-friendly lids with holes, flip-top or press-on quick-sip lids, and drink‑through or wide‑mouth lids that let kids sip directly.
Some lids or straw components include post‑consumer recycled content—for example, lids made with about 20% post‑consumer recycled polypropylene and straws or metal parts made from certified recycled steel (listed as around 90% post‑consumer recycled content).
Straw components can use recycled metal (certified ~90% post‑consumer recycled steel), and tips are often food‑grade silicone or soft silicone flex tips for comfort.
Age labels vary: some lids are marked for about 12 months and up, while others are labeled for roughly 3 years and up—check each product listing for the recommended age range.
